The soft crunch of gravel underfoot and the gentle rustle of canvas mark your arrival at this no-frills touring site in the Staffordshire countryside, where open skies and uncomplicated pitching await beneath mature hedgerows.
This is a site for tourers who value straightforward camping without unnecessary embellishments—ideal for those exploring Central England's canal networks, the nearby Peak District fringes, or Staffordshire's pottery heritage towns. The year-round opening makes it particularly useful for winter tourers and those seeking a practical base rather than a resort-style experience. Tent campers, caravanners and motorhomers all find space here among the well-maintained grounds.
Facilities stick to the essentials with toilets and showers serving the pitches, while the campfire policy requires checking on arrival—worth confirming if you're hoping for evening flames. The unpretentious atmosphere suits independent campers who bring their own entertainment and appreciate a quiet, functional site where the focus remains on the surrounding Staffordshire landscape rather than onsite attractions.
